They're located in a shopping plaza so they have plenty of parking. We stopped in on a Tuesday evening, so the place wasn't too busy, thankfully, for a weeknight. We had 6 in total for our party. I love the number of options that they have to offer and am glad they also had a variety of food. The wait staff was friendly and patient with the questions we had about our order. We did have to wait a while for our order of 7 deinks and 7 food items. The drinks came out first, then the ramen and then the noodles and rice. The drinks were delicious, and the galaxy teas were so pretty!! It was definitely difficult to select just one option to try. If you go with a large party and they're willing to share, I would definitely recommend going that route!! A must try spot if you're in the area.

This place could definitely use some redecorating. There was a mid match of themes going on and the place felt a little bit dingy. But don't judge a book by its cover! The food was delicious ! We had the chicken Katsu and Yakiudon. In both meals the chicken was tender and moist. The udon noodles were chewy and NOT mushy. The drinks were a bit too sweet even after changing the levels. I'll have to try the drinks again. BUT the STAR OF THE SHOW of the Soft Serve Ube!! ITS LACTOSE FREE and was delicious! It's didn't have a heavy ube taste where it just tastes like a potato but it had a more Ube Vanilla taste to it which I prefer. The mochis in the ice cream was also very soft and chewy!
